Pelicans C DeMarcus Cousins Will Play Wednesday Night Against the Mavericks

After missing the past two games with a sprained right ankle, New Orleans Pelicans center DeMarcus Cousins is in the starting lineup for the team's outing against the Dallas Mavericks on Wednesday night. Cousins had been questionable heading in, but was able to take part in the team's shootaround prior to being made available. 

More than anything, this limits Anthony Davis' ceiling from a fantasy perspective. He was averaging 33.5 points and 16.0 rebounds with Cousins sidelined. The two have yet to really find a way to work with one another after Cousins was acquired from Sacramento back in February. It also doesn't help that the Pelicans are taking on a Mavericks defense that is yielding the third-fewest points to fantasy centers on the season. 

While both Davis and Cousins should be considered top-end year-long options here, their values in the DFS community just aren't what they once were when they played on different teams.
